LV03 LUE is a 2003 Renault Megane in Blue with a 1,390c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 16 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 62.5%.
Across all 2003 Renault Megane models, the average MOT pass rate is 65.6% with a typical mileage of 66,047 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Renault Megane f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 358,622 recorded failures. If you're considering buying LV03 LUE,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Renault Megane typically stays on UK roads for around 30 years. At 23 years old, this Renault Megane is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
